Multi-Standard High-Definition Video Decoder (MSVD-HD)
The Multi-Standard High-Definition Video Decoder (MSVD-HD) is one of the smallest synthesizable cores in the market, performing time multiplexed decoding of multiple streams in different standards at all resolutions up to 2048x2048 pixels. It is substantially smaller than a fully programmable solution. The MSVD-HD is a real-time solution for dual-stream high-definition video decoding with a single core at a low clock rate.

Other Features & Benefits
- Supported standards:
- ITU-T H.264, ISO/IEC 14496-10 (main and high profile up to level 4.2)
- SMPTE 421M VC-1 (simple, main and advanced profile @ level 4)
- ISO/IEC 11172-2 MPEG-1
- ISO/IEC 13818-2 MPEG-2 (main profile @ high level)
- Supports all DVB, ATSC, HDTV, DVD, VCD resolutions (e.g. 1080p, 1080i, 720p, D1)
- Supports picture size from 48x32 pixel to 2048x2048 pixel
- Error detection and concealment
- Trick mode support
- Processing of ES and PES streams, extraction and provision of time stamps
- SoC prototyping on FPGA including ASIC bus interconnect and DDR2 SDRAM
- Allegro H.264 certification test suite proven
- 64-bit ports to memory system, OCP 2.0 and AMBA AXI compliant
Key Advantages
- Silicon area efficient solution
- True multi-stream decoding features:
- HD dual-stream processing performance
- Multiple streams (up to 16 supported by HW, minimal SW support)
- Applications are program preview, multiple thumbnail streams
- Fine granular context switching between streams on macroblock row level:
- Minimizes memory requirements for input buffers
- Minimizes input to output delay
- Simultaneous multi-stream and multi-standard decoding:
- E.g. one HD H.264 and one HD MPEG-2 stream
Performance
- Dual-stream decode up to 1080i @ 30 fps at 150MHz core clock frequency
- Single-stream decode up to 1080p @ 60 fps at 150MHz core clock frequency
- Time multiplexed multi-stream decoding with fine granular context switching, possible combinations are:
- Two HD video streams H.264, VC-1, MPEG-2
- One H.264 HD stream and four VC-1 SD streams
- One HD stream and 16 CIF streams
- Hardwired, autonomously running decoding pipeline, two samples per clock throughput
- Hardware supported context switching between video streams (configurable up to 16 streams)
- MSVD-HD core and memory system can run with different clocks; clock domain crossing is part of MSVD-HD
